A bit more on this one, he was a Spitfire pilot in WW2 and spent time as a POW in Lubeck.
After the war he raced Alta's, Rouen in !947, He became she in 1951 and continued racing in Alta's, She also held the Ladies Hill record at Shelsley Walsh, 1972 saw her last race in the Kitchener-Mclaren at Rufforth, a F5000 race. She also owned a DH Mosquito during the late 50's.

Its the idea EB. Moons ago ACO invented strange things,,like a "valise" to put in a luggage compartment and a spare wheel. Then the spare wheel was mandatory in some categories only, like GTP. I think the suitcase is always up to date for GT's.
